What components matter most for smooth streaming and fast play
First be sure the processor and graphics card can handle streaming and gaming without bottlenecks. A modern multi core CPU and a capable GPU improve encoding quality and frame rate. Next add fast solid state storage and at least 16 gigabytes of memory. Finally use a reliable network connection and an efficient power supply for long hours of streaming.
How to choose a gaming rig for casino streaming step by step
- Decide your budget and then pick a CPU with at least six cores for smooth multitasking.
- Pair the CPU with a capable graphics card that supports hardware encoding for streaming.
- Install at least 16 gigabytes of fast memory and a solid state drive for quick load times.
- Choose a motherboard with good USB ports and expansion options for peripherals.
- Set up a reliable network with ethernet as the primary link and use a quality router.
- Test your rig with a stream and casino game mixture before going live.

Should you upgrade or build a new rig for streaming
Upgrading is often enough if you have a recent CPU and GPU. If your current system struggles with encoding or you notice stuttering during live streams, a new rig with modern components is a solid move. Consider upgrading storage speed and memory first to maximize return on investment.
How to optimize for better performance during casino sessions
- Close unnecessary programs and background tasks to free resources for streaming.
- Enable hardware encoding in your streaming software if available.
- Use a wired ethernet connection instead of wifi for the most reliable signal.
- Keep software and drivers up to date to prevent compatibility issues during streams.
- Monitor temperatures and ensure adequate cooling during long sessions.
FAQ about gaming rigs for casino streams and fast play
What is the best cpu for casino streaming A modern six to eight core cpu from the current generation provides a strong balance of game and encoding performance for casino streams.
Do I need a high end graphics card for streaming You can start with a mid range card that supports hardware encoding and upgrade if you want higher resolution streams or better quality during competitive play.
How much memory should I have Aim for at least 16 gigabytes of memory and 32 gigabytes if you run multiple apps or plan heavy multitasking while streaming.
Is ethernet better than wifi for streaming Yes ethernet is more stable and reduces latency which matters during fast play sessions and live bets.
What storage setup works best A fast NVMe solid state drive for the operating system and games plus a secondary drive for recordings and backups keeps things fast and organized.
